Kent County, Michigan, Launches Truancy Court Pilot Program
Kent County in Michigan recently launched a Truancy Court pilot program to address student absenteeism. The State of Michigan 17th Circuit Court announced the launch on February 16, 2017; it will initially focus on students in the Wyoming and Godwin Heights school districts. The goal is to connect students and their families with community-based services to overcome attendance barriers.
The Truancy Court pilot program provides up to 20 attorneys working pro bono for the students. Those students and families needing services will have access through Network180 and the Circuit Court’s Crisis Intervention Program.
